Brian Leck

With heavy hearts, we are sad to announce the passing of our friend, colleague, and founding partner, Brian Leck, on November 17, 2022. He was 77.

Brian, along with Fred Allen, Mike Matkins, John Gamble, and Rick Mallory, friends and partners at the firm of Stephens, Jones, LaFever & Smith, founded Allen, Matkins, Leck, Gamble & Mallory with a different vision – spending their professional lives with attorneys they liked and respected and to “do great work for great clients.”

Brian served as managing partner from the firm's founding in 1977 until 2011. He steered the firm through times of transition and great success, including some of the largest and most complicated real estate transactions in California. The firm grew from five lawyers into an AmLaw 200 firm with more than 225 lawyers. Brian later served as an advisor to the managing partner before retiring in 2019. As a practicing attorney, Brian had extensive experience in mergers and acquisitions, corporate securities, and executive employment and consulting agreements. Brian received a B.A. from Stanford University in 1967 and J.D. from UCLA School of Law in 1970, where he served on the Law Review.

During his illustrious career, Brian served as the President to the board of the L.A. County Sheriff’s Children’s College Scholarship Fund. Its mission was to provide scholarships to the children of active L.A. County Sheriffs. Over the years, more than $1.6 million was raised and helped support over 125 students.
